Application Developer Resume
SUMMARY:
- Over 10 years of Experience in IT as Programmer, DBA, Business Analyst and QA Analyst.
- 5+ years in Data Analysis, testing software applications, Documenting the Business and Functional Requirements for various projects, 5 years in Oracle, PL/SQL, SQL, Pro*C, Forms and Reports, 3 years in SQL server and T - SQL. Involved in developing and testing of software’s for the major companies, hotels, educational institutes, financial companies, hospitals, telecom and energy companies.
- Involved in Design, Coding and in Data Flow Diagrams.
- Extensively worked on Pro*C in various projects involving data manipulation, data cleansing and data analysis.
- Created Layouts of system Screens and Reports before actual programming.
- Involved in Data Analysis and Data validation.
- Extensively worked on SQL, PL/SQL, Procedures, functions, triggers.
- Provided necessary data validation checks against data entry using procedures.
- Created Stored Procedures in Oracle, SQL server. And queries in Access.
- Generated Documentation for the Code.
- Extensively worked on data imports from various file formats into Oracle.
- Microsoft Certified in Visual Basic technology.
- Worked in 24/7 production support environment.
- Received on the Spot Excellence Award for outstanding work at Confidential .
- Conceptual knowledge of Health Management, Energy and Retail industry and Oracle RAC.
TECHNICAL SKILLS:
Languages: Visual Basic 5.0 (Microsoft Certified) / 6.0, PL/SQL, COBOL, BASIC, ABAP/4, Pro*C, Java/J2EE, Shell Scripting
DBMS: Oracle 11i/10g/9i/8/11i, MS-Access, MS-SQL Server 2000/2005, Informix
OS: MS-DOS, UNIX, Windows 98/2000, Windows NT, IBM AIX
ERP: SAP R/3 (Finance Module), Oracle Financial (AP, PO, GL, AR, OIE)
Reporting: Crystal Reports (Till Ver 8), Active Reports, Data Reports, Business objects 6.5
GUI Tools: Developer/2000(Forms 4.5/6.0, Reports 2.5/6.0), TOAD, 4gl, PLSQL Developer
SC Tools: PVCS, SCCS, VSS
Others: DAO/RDO/ADO, COM, JDBC, ODBC, MQ Series, Test Director, Extra, EZ Tools, ReconNet (Cash Management Tool), Allegro
Web Tech: PWS, VBScript, ASP, HTML, JSP, VB.NET, Web sphere, HTML, OAF
PROFESSIONAL EXPERIENCE
Confidential
Application Developer
- Developed several transformation logics using PL/SQL Functions and procedures to load the external vendor files into Data warehouse.
- Extensively worked on ETL techniques to load various external and internal files into data warehouse.
- Created customized process as per business requirement in FiServ InformEnt Warehouse Architect 9.0, Process Manager.
- Create conceptual, logical, and physical data models in design document to define the informational needs of the DW.
- Developed system test scripts, unit test scripts, detail design documents for the enhancements.
- Develop data extraction, transformation, and loading strategies and document the data movement through data flow diagrams.
- Collaborate and communicate with DBA, BA, and ETL teams to correctly implement the projects.
- Using oracle external tables extensively to improve performance of the file loads.
- Using ASG Zena software extensively for Jobs scheduling by event basis and loading the files.
- Working collaboratively with DBA and Data Architect teams on releases, new development and performance Improvement enhancements and issues.
- Use Oracle OEM for identifying any oracle related issues.
- Support on-call production on a regular rotation basis.
- Developed data Mappings between source systems and warehouse components.
- Created views, pl/sql objects to support downstream applications. Written pl/sql procedures to populate data marts into facts and dimension tables.
- Used parallel, upsert and external tables for data loads from external files to oracle tables using business Transformation Rules.
- Created logical model and deployed the code into TFS architecture using Visual Studio.
- Developed and implemented several deployment documentation tasks and procedures for the team.
Environment: Oracle 12c, SQL, PL/SQL, Shell scripting, Linux, MS Office, ASG Zena, TFS, MS SQL Server 2013.
Confidential
Application Developer
- Worked on both Agile and Waterfall methodology based development and testing.
- Written complex SQL queries against complex database schemas for analysis, data validation and PL/SQL development to support various projects in Commissions systems.
- Created project specific application design documents and test cases based on the functional and system requirements.
- Created new mappings and written transformation rules in Informatica.
- Written various shell scripts to call pl/sql packages for various projects.
- Received two I-Recognize awards for successful completion of projects with no defects and under budget.
- Worked with development and data architect to stream line the database schema objects.
- Helped in optimizing SQL Queries along with development team. Worked with DBA team to create and deploy database objects.
- Worked on Tele Logic tool for configuration management software for code versioning.
- Created Test Cases for unit testing and help testers in understanding the data and the process
- Work with QA team, create and manage system/regression test cases and user accepting testing scripts for all the projects.
Environment: Oracle 10g, SQL, PL/SQL, Shell scripting, Unix, MS Office, Informatica 9.1, Control-M, TeleLogic.
Confidential
Oracle/SQL Server DBA and PLSQL Developer
- Assist with the establishment and management of user access processes; design and implement security architecture and fine grained access controls.
- Involved in Data migration from SQL server system to Oracle. Written various scripts to load data between systems.
- Monitor security breaches, error logs, log space, user activity and resource utilization of production environment
- Collaborate with project teams as required, and assist application programmer in determining needs, setting priorities, creating project plans and setting schedule for installations/upgrades
- Maintain the ERP project team's self-service and .NET applications.
- Provide assistance in SQL, PL/SQL development and tuning
- Applying and testing Oracle patches; apply application patches from vendors in non-production and production environments
- Provide after-hours on-call support and document all related procedures
- Maintain and upgrade ERP modules and applications that are part of the Sungard Banner ERP eco-system.
- Document and implement procedures for database backup and recovery using various technologies.
- Develop, maintain, and implement procedures to guarantee the accuracy, accessibility and responsiveness of the database environment, ensuring optimal database performance and availability including the identification, analysis, and resolution of complex database issues.
- Provide assistance to applications developers in the effective use of database query and programming languages.
- Become a resource on a variety of database integration issues including migration between disparate databases, data conversion, capacity planning, and new application deployments.
- Developed components of applications packages using SQL, PL/SQL, HTML, and CSS. Captured and refined users requirements as a part of new development. Performed Data Analysis and User Acceptance testing as needed mainly using the tools SQL Developer, MS Excel, SQL.
- Create, maintain and refresh required Oracle instances/databases for development, test and production environments.
- Design and implement new standards, procedures and supporting scripts for Oracle installation and administration Help the development team with performance tuning and code rewrites.
- Create, maintain and upgrade development, QA, integration and pre-production database environments.
- Development and production Oracle DBA for Oracle 10g on Windows. Creation and maintenance of 10g standby databases using RMAN and Import/Export Utilities.
- Achieve day-to-day operational database administration and data management, proactive monitoring and support Participate in 24/7 support.
- Used Link Server to retrieve ERP data from Oracle to SQL Server.
Environment: Oracle 10g, Oracle 11i, SQL Server 2003, PLSQL developer, HTML, CSS, RMAN, Forms 10, IIS, VB.NET
Confidential
Oracle/PLSQL Web Reports Developer
- Work with the End users to collect business requirements.
- Wrote complex SQL queries against complex database schemas for analysis, data validation and reporting using PL/SQL.
- Written PL/SQL procedures, functions, SQL Statements.
- Developed SQL scripts for ETL process to load the Oracle data into MS Access environment.
- Work with development and design teams to clarify and communicate functional and technical requirements.
- Developed various reports in web environment using PLSQL tool kit for users to access from Internet browsers.
- Validated the data for reporting purposes to ensure data validity in the reports.
- Analyzed various business process and developed requirements for process changes.
- Wrote scripts to download the oracle data into Access for various reports.
Environment: Oracle 10g, TOAD, SQL, PL/SQL, Shell scripting, Unix, Windows 2003, MS Access 2007, MS Office, HTML, PLSQL Web Tool Kit, Visual Basic 6.
Confidential - Kansas City, KS
Technical/Business Consultant
- Work with the users to collect business requirements.
- Wrote complex SQL queries against complex database schemas for analysis, data validation and reporting using PL/SQL.
- Written PL/SQL procedures, functions, SQL Statements, Views to support the projects.
- Developed SQL scripts for ETL process to load the external data into data warehouse environment.
- Create business and functional requirements documentation in DOORS repository.
- Work with development and design teams to clarify and communicate functional and technical requirements.
- Write and optimize SQL Queries along with development team. Work with DBA team to create and deploy initial schema.
- Use Tele Logic tool for configuration management software for version management.
- Create Test Cases for system and User Acceptance tests, validate the test cases and upload the same into Quality Center.
- Validate the test results from the development team and complete the testing steps in HP Quality Center.
- Work with QA team, create and manage system/regression test cases and user accepting testing scripts for all the products using test director.
- Prepare QA Manual and process maps for each type of testing.
- Create and maintain traceability matrix between requirements and test cases.
- Conduct and complete User Acceptance Test for various projects and various builds.
- Create Test Exit review document for final review before production code drop.
Environment: Oracle 10g, TOAD, SQL, PL/SQL, Shell scripting, C, Pro*C, Unix, EDP, Telelogic, DOORS, Windows 2003, MS Visio, MS Access, MS Project, MS Office, HP Quality Center.
Confidential
Consultant
- The module is tightly integrated with Accounts Payable module.
- Design, code and tested the inbound and outbound credit card interface using SQL loader.
- Extensively worked on writing SQL queries, procedures according to the business requirements.
- Worked in customizing the workflow using JDeveloper as per the requirements.
- Extensively worked on customizing the XML documents based on user requirements.
- Customized the seeded code in Oracle Application Framework and personalization.
- Involved in performance tuning for various PL/SQL procedures and data load programs.
- Developed ad-hoc queries to support business requirements using TOAD.
- Extensively worked on writing interfaces for data loads from AP, AR to OIE.
- Written Pro*C programs to generate internal reports for business validation purpose.
- Analyzed various data structures to write data load programs to retrieve external data.
Environment: Oracle 11i, Oracle E Business suite 11i, Oracle Internet Expense version K, IBM AIX, UNIX, PL/SQL, SQL, ProC, JDeveloper, Oracle Application Framework, Java, XML, HTML, TOAD.
Confidential - St. Louis, MO
Consultant
- Worked with cross functional groups like sales and finance to meet their schedules and deadlines.
- Extensively worked on building complex views, SQL using 9i/10g features for reporting.
- Worked in system integration and object-oriented software development.
- Worked from inception, to scoping, requirements gathering, analysis/design, construction, testing/QA, deployment, maintenance/support and change management.
- Wrote complex SQL queries against complex database schemas for analysis, data validation and reporting using PL/SQL.
- Written PL/SQL procedures, functions, SQL Statements, Views to support the projects.
- Worked in Customer Support role to resolve customer complaints with software and responded to suggestions for improvement and demonstrated software to technical and non-technical business users.
- Written Pro*C programs for data transfer between various systems. Used Pro*C as an ETL tool.
- Supported the business users during month-end, quarter-end and year-end financial close cycles.
- Extensively used PLSQL Developer tool for DDL and DML operations.
- Worked on optimizing existing PL/SQL Packages.
- Generated several ad-hoc reports to support Sales and Financial applications.
- Extensively worked in generating reports from and to Excel to MS SQL Server.
Environment: Oracle 10g/9i, Visual Basic 6.0, MS SQL Server, PL/SQL, SQL, Pro*C, Allegro 7.7, VB .NET 2.0, PLSQL, Developer, Win XP, Business Objects ver 6.5, Zabo, VSS.
Confidential- Kansas City, KS
Technical Consultant
- Payment Operations Enterprise Tool is an Accounts Receivables tool which handles and reconciles the Payments from the bank to Treasury.
Environment: Oracle 8.x/9.x, PL/SQL, SQL, VSS, PLSQL Developer, Extra, Visual Basic 6, ReconNet, MZ tools and Win XP, VB.NET.
Confidential, Rochester, NY
Technical Consultant
- Worked on Paychex Accounts Receivables Invoice System is a field database that store’s all billing information. When the field runs a payroll or the month end billing process, the EIP records are inserted into the PARIS System. The Fetret—Fetch and Return process copies this information from PARIS into the corporate system. ACH records are then automatically created and sent to the bank.
Environment: Oracle 9i/10g, Oracle 9 IAS, Forms 6i, Reports 6i, PL/SQL, SQL, SQL Loader, Pro *C, Unix, Rational tools, Clear Case, Toad, Win XP, SQR and Shell Scripting.
Confidential - Kansas City, KS
Technical Consultant and Lead Oracle Developer
- Worked on CIRAS CIRcuit Administration System; a standard engineering system that provides an industry standard design process for Access and Non-Access Circuit Provisioning, Facility, and Trunk Design. This is an Inventory Management System. Worked on C2P Circuit to Packet Edits involved in analyzing programs with the current business requirements.
- The work involved was studying the CIRAS forms and mapping it into Excel spreadsheet for analyzing the current business process. Document the program flow and logic to identify the obsolete code.
- This project is a conversion project. Worked on CIRAS production support involved in fixing the data and code problems. Users will open a ticket (bug) if they find any problems in CIRAS system. Using Forms 6i and Reports 6i and Oracle 9i as database on Unix Aix Servers.
Environment: Oracle 8/9i, Forms 4.5/6i, Reports 2.5/6i, PL/SQL, SQL, SQL Loader, Pro *C, Unix, PVCS, Toad, Test Director, Win NT, MQ Series and Shell Scripting.
Confidential, California
Oracle Developer
- USL Financial Systems was a conversion project (from SQL Server) involving complete reengineering the existing applications to Oracle environment using Developer 2000 in client server technology on a 3 - TIER System. The total system involved 7 modules; Account Receivables, Account Payables, Control System, Purchase Order, General Ledger, Inventory and Payroll. Involved in designing, coding flowcharting the Processes and created written specifications for the scope of new Application. Created database triggers according to the business rules. Created complex queries (stored procedures) to control from the back end.
- Created Layouts of system Screens and Reports before actual programming. Developed Stored procedures, Triggers for validation against user inputs. Reporting tool used to create ad-hoc reports was in Oracle reports.
Environment: Oracle 8i, PL/SQL, SQL Server, TOAD, Win NT, PVCS.
SAP(ABAP) Consultant
Confidential
Environment: SAP R/3 4.6C
- Role in the implementation phase was a team member. The implementation was in FI/CO and CD (Collection and Disbursement) modules. The project involved in data transfers from the legacy to SAP system. The interfaces were online with business process validations.
Environnent: SAP R/3, ABAP, Oracle, Win NT.
Confidential, California
Technical Consultant
- System involved in the reconciling the Accounts receivables and cash between the company accounts and bank statements. The system is developed in Oracle Developer 2000 in client server technology. The system has 7 types of files, which we import from the AREV system into the access database, with parsing of the ach, csv, dat, prn, txt files into the Oracle system with parsing routines.
- The transactions are posted (moving from daybook to general ledger) and reconcile the transactions with the bank records. Generated various reports using oracle reports and in the excel spreadsheet. The project involved in developing Financial Reports for Accounts Receivables, Projected Receivables, Cash Reconciliation, Deferred Revenue and Expense Modeling.
- Responsible to code import routines, design the front end, code and Quality Assurance for Financial Reports. Developed detail exception Report’s to identify data anomalies and to assist in reconcilement process. Involved in develop code for returns, return analysis, user profiles, flowcharting, documenting, design and performance tuning of files importing into the system. Designed GUI and developed reports. Developed modules to parse, validate and error processing. Extensively used excel as reporting tool. Developed security modules to restrict the user to access only the specified screens under his work group.
Environment: Oracle 8, Developer 2000, Excel, Win NT and PVCS.